Residents struggle to move through the flooded streets of Buenos Aires.<br/> <br />Large swathes of the province remain submerged after torrential rains, Wednesday.<br/> <br />Historic tourist destinations are inaccessible to most visitors, and homes are flooded. Some residents are having a hard time finding dry clothes.<br/> <br />(SOUNDBITE) (Spanish) RESIDENT AND FLOOD VICTIM, SAYING:<br/> <br />"I have to ask my sisters-in-law for clothing for the children because they don't even have something to put on, all of the clothes got wet."<br/> <br />The locals have seen it all before -- the area is prone to flooding.<br/> <br />But it's of little comfort to those who are still waiting for power lines to be repaired, electricity to be restored, and life to return to normal.
